Blackketter, P.E., Director of Public Works SUBJECT P.O. #6005 -Accept Property Deed and Dedicate ROW for Anchor Dr. DATE 28 April 2009 RECOMMENDATION: I recommend that the City Council approve Proposed Ordinance No. 6005, accepting a deed for street right-of-way for Anchor Drive and dedicating said right-of-way for public use. BACKGROUND: In Proposed Resolution 15228 on this agenda, we recommend the City Council accept the public infrastructure for the extension of Anchor Drive southward to Lake Arthur Drive. The property owner, Redwine Family Partners, has also deeded the property comprising the 60 feet wide right-of-way to the City for this street. BUDGETARY/FISCAL EFFECT: None. AN ORDINANCE ACCEPTING THE DEED FORA 60 FOOT WIDE STREET RIGHT-OF-WAY OUT OF AND A PART OF LOTS 2 AND7, BLOCK 11, RANGE "7", PORT ARTHUR LAND COMPANY SUBDIVISION IN PORT ARTHUR, TEXAS FROM REDWINE FAMILY PARTNERS, LTD. AND DEDICATING THE 60 FOOT WIDE STREET RIGHT-OF-WAY FOR ANCHOR DRIVE EXTENSION, FOR A DISTANCE OF 1360.19 FEET. BE IT ORDAINED BY THE CITY COUNCIL OF THE CITY OF PORT ARTHUR: THAT, the City of Port Arthur, a municipal corporation incorporated under and by virtue of the Constitution and laws of Texas and domiciled in Jefferson County, Texas hereby accept the Deed fora 60 foot wide street right-of-way from Redwine Family Partners, LTD., a copy of which is attached hereto and made a part hereof as Exhibit "A"; and, THAT, the City Council of the City of Port Arthur hereby dedicates said 60 foot wide tract for public use and designates it as a portion of the right-of-way for Anchor Drive; and, THAT, The City of Port Arthur shall hereafter maintain said tract of land as a public street right-of-way; and, THAT, a copy of this ordinance shall be recorded in the office of the County Clerk of Jefferson County; and, THAT, this being an Ordinance not requiring publication the same shall take effect and be in force immediately from and after its passage; and, THAT, if any portion of this Ordinance shall, for any reason, be declared invalid by a court of competent jurisdiction, such invalidity shall not affect the remaining provisions hereof. THAT, a copy of the caption of this Ordinance be spread upon the Minutes of the City Council.
